Speech and Language Support for 3-5s%u00a9 Elklan Training Limited 2023 164S88.2.7 Small World Play or %u2018play with miniatures%u2019(ELB. 91, Slide 235)%u2022 Explain what is meant by %u2018Small World Play%u2019 resources.%u2022 Around 18 months the child begins to recognise miniature/Small World toys. %u2022 Show the miniature or Small World brush and demonstrate brushing a Small World Ted%u2019s hair with it.8.2.8 The link between Small World Play and language development(Slide 236)%u2022 Explain the importance of this in terms of Symbolic Understanding.%u2022 The child realises that one object (a miniature brush) can stand for another (a real brush) just as a word can stand for/represent an object. %u2022 This suggests that not only has the child stored information about the concept/idea of an object e.g. a brush, but now he has acquired the critical level of abstractness/Symbolic Understanding to develop language and thinking.%u2022 His mind is now ready to create new puzzle frameworks/concepts for objects, actions and other experiences really quickly and efficiently and so he learns vocabulary at a rapid rate.
